Latest Patents

Mukouyama holds a patent for an air conditioner and its manufacturing method. The patent describes a heat exchanger that includes fins arranged in parallel with a predetermined spacing along the rotational axis direction of a blower. Heat exchanger tubes are inserted into the fins to form rows along the longitudinal direction of the fins, creating refrigerant channels. A branch portion is provided at the connection points of the heat exchanger tubes to adjust the number of paths in the refrigerant channels. This design allows refrigerant to flow through various channels, enhancing the overall performance of the air conditioning system.
